Wellbeing Walks are short walks, run by friendly, specially trained volunteer walk leaders, who are on hand to provide encouragement and support. All walks are free of charge and are open to everyone – you don’t need to preregister, just come along and join us. The routes start and finish at the same location as advertised, and last between 30 and 90 minutes. A gentle pace walk with a qualified instructor.
This group exercise class is designed to help the elderly improve physical fitness, strength, and balance. The exercises within the class are progressed slowly according to your abilities, and within the same group people normally progress at different rates. The exercises are specifically developed to help you feel steadier on your feet and improve your confidence in getting around on your own. The POWER OF THE POLES Induction course is suitable for all levels and is a structured teaching programme. Your qualified Instructor will help you understand your current level of fitness and empower you to use poles at the correct intensity in order to get the results you want. At the end of this session you will have a full understanding of using poles correctly and allowing you to join walks & classes all around the UK. The strapless poles are provided.
